Never mind.. hada brain **** when i wrote that last reply.. i was thinking about sampling instructions.
In the COA profile you are saynig they are required? Then how are you seeing the COA? The COA shouldn't even print if a required characteristic is missing?
So if that condition is being meet, the COA program might actually be getting the data. It might be some logic in the SAPscript.
It's hard to help since you have custom program for QC21. One of the reasons I highly recommend you don't put in a custom program for COA's. I have a blog here in SCN about it. You might want to read it. Not that it will help you much right now with this specific issue now.
An ABAP'er in debug might be your best bet to figure it out.
